The Rise of Digital-First Financial Systems

One of the most visible changes in finance is the shift toward fully digital systems. Physical cash is gradually becoming obsolete as digital wallets, contactless payments, and online banking dominate everyday transactions.
In the near future, we are likely to see:
- A cashless society, where digital payments are the norm
- Biometric authentication replacing passwords
- Seamless cross-border transactions with minimal fees
- Real-time financial tracking and analytics for individuals
Digital-first finance offers unmatched convenience, but it also raises questions about privacy and data security. As systems become more interconnected, protecting sensitive financial information will become a top priority.
Artificial Intelligence: The Brain Behind Future Finance

Artificial Intelligence (AI) is set to become the backbone of financial decision-making. Already, algorithms are being used to analyze markets, detect fraud, and personalize financial services.
In the future, AI will:
- Provide hyper-personalized financial advice based on your habits
- Predict market trends with increasing accuracy
- Automate investing through smart portfolios
- Detect fraudulent activity instantly
Imagine having a virtual financial advisor that understands your goals, spending patterns, and risk tolerance better than any human ever could. This is not science fiction—it’s already beginning to happen.
However, reliance on AI also introduces risks, such as algorithmic bias and overdependence on automated systems. Balancing human oversight with machine efficiency will be crucial.
Blockchain and the Decentralization of Money

Blockchain technology is transforming the recording and verification of transactions. It makes financial transactions quicker, less expensive, and more transparent by cutting out middlemen.
Important advancements consist of:
Cryptocurrencies as substitute value stores
Platforms for decentralized finance (DeFi) that provide investments and loans without the need for banks
Smart contracts that, when certain conditions are met, automatically execute
Enhanced financial system transparency
Blockchain has enormous potential, but it also has drawbacks like scalability, regulation, and environmental issues. Institutions and governments are still figuring out how to responsibly integrate these systems.
The Evolution of Banking: From Institutions to Platforms
Financial services are no longer exclusively controlled by traditional banks. Rather, we are shifting to a platform-based model in which financial services are integrated into commonplace applications.
You might not even «go to a bank» in the future. Rather:
Payments may be handled by your messaging apps or social media accounts.
E-commerce sites might provide loans right away.
Your everyday digital experiences will incorporate financial services.
This change, referred to as embedded finance, is already altering how companies operate.te. Companies that adapt quickly will thrive, while those that resist innovation may struggle to survive.
The Role of Big Data in Financial Decision-Making
In the digital age, data is the new currency. Large volumes of data are being gathered by financial institutions in order to better comprehend consumer behavior and market dynamics.
The future of finance will involve the following thanks to big data:
Credit scoring in real time based on actions rather than just past
More precise risk evaluation for investments and loans
Personalized financial products made to meet each person’s needs
Customers will benefit from more individualized services as a result. However, it also brings up issues with data collection, storage, and utilization. Ethical data practices and transparency will be prioritized.
Financial Inclusion: A Global Opportunity
The potential of future finance to provide financial services to marginalized communities is among its most promising features. Basic banking is still unavailable to millions of people worldwide.
That can be altered by technology by offering:
Mobile banking options in isolated places
Cheap online accounts
Using smartphones to access international markets
Financial inclusion can boost economic growth, empower people, and lessen poverty. But governments, tech firms, and financial institutions must work together.
